Understanding the Dual Criteria: ISO 9001 Certification and Stainless Steel Construction

When evaluating security camera suppliers for B2B procurement, two criteria consistently emerge as primary decision factors: ISO 9001 quality management certification and stainless steel housing construction. These attributes signal different aspects of supplier capability and product durability, yet they're often misunderstood or conflated by buyers new to the security equipment import business.

ISO 9001 is not a product certification—it's a quality management system standard that certifies the manufacturer's processes, not the individual camera units. When a security camera factory holds ISO 9001 certification, it means their production workflows, from raw material inspection through final testing, follow documented quality control procedures that meet international standards. This translates to consistent output quality, traceable defect resolution, and systematic continuous improvement [3].

Stainless steel construction, on the other hand, is a material specification that directly impacts product durability and environmental resistance. For security cameras deployed in harsh conditions—coastal areas with salt air exposure, industrial zones with chemical pollutants, or outdoor installations facing extreme weather—stainless steel housings (typically grades 304 or 316) provide superior corrosion resistance compared to aluminum alloy or plastic alternatives.

ISO 9001 Certification: What It Really Means for Security Camera Procurement

Many B2B buyers assume ISO 9001 certification is a mark of product quality. In reality, it's a process quality assurance credential. Understanding what ISO 9001 does and doesn't cover is essential for setting realistic expectations when evaluating suppliers on Alibaba.com.

What ISO 9001 Certification Covers:

  • Documented quality management procedures across all production stages
  • Raw material inspection protocols with traceable records
  • In-process quality control checkpoints
  • Final product testing standards and documentation
  • Customer complaint handling and corrective action systems
  • Regular internal audits and management reviews
  • Continuous improvement mechanisms

What ISO 9001 Does NOT Guarantee:

  • Specific product performance metrics (resolution, low-light sensitivity, etc.)
  • Material grade specifications (stainless steel 304 vs 316 vs aluminum)
  • Product longevity or warranty terms
  • Pricing competitiveness
  • Delivery timeline adherence

Stainless Steel Housing: Material Grades, Environmental Suitability, and Cost Implications

Stainless steel camera housings are marketed as premium options, but not all stainless steel is created equal. Understanding the differences between grades and their appropriate applications helps buyers avoid overpaying for unnecessary specifications—or under-specifying for harsh environments.

Common Stainless Steel Grades for Camera Housings:

Grade 304 (A2 Stainless): The most widely used stainless steel for security camera housings. Contains 18% chromium and 8% nickel. Provides good corrosion resistance for most outdoor applications including urban environments, moderate coastal areas, and industrial zones without heavy chemical exposure. Cost premium over aluminum: approximately 20-30%.

Grade 316 (A4 Stainless/Marine Grade): Contains 16% chromium, 10% nickel, and 2% molybdenum. The molybdenum addition significantly improves resistance to chlorides, making it ideal for coastal installations, marine environments, and areas with de-icing salt exposure. Cost premium over aluminum: approximately 35-50%.

Grade 316L (Low Carbon): Similar to 316 but with lower carbon content for improved weld corrosion resistance. Used in specialized applications requiring extensive welding or fabrication. Cost premium: 45-60% over aluminum.

For Southeast Asian importers, the environmental context matters significantly. Singapore, Malaysia, and coastal Thailand experience high humidity and salt air exposure, making stainless steel 304 or 316 a justified investment for outdoor installations. Indonesia and Philippines, with their archipelagic geography, present similar challenges for coastal deployments.

However, for inland applications in countries like Laos, Cambodia, or inland Thailand, aluminum alloy housings with proper powder coating often provide adequate protection at lower cost. The key is matching material specification to actual deployment conditions rather than defaulting to premium options.

Warranty Considerations: Stainless steel housings typically come with longer warranty periods (3-5 years) compared to aluminum (2-3 years) or plastic (1-2 years). However, warranty terms vary significantly by supplier, and ISO 9001 certified manufacturers often provide more reliable warranty fulfillment due to their documented quality systems.

Supplier Qualification Checklist: Dual Criteria Evaluation Framework

Based on industry best practices and real-world deployment experiences, we've developed a comprehensive supplier qualification checklist for evaluating ISO 9001 certified stainless steel camera manufacturers. This framework helps B2B buyers systematically assess potential partners on Alibaba.com.

Phase 1: Documentation Verification (Pre-Contact)

Before engaging suppliers, verify the following documentation availability:

  • ISO 9001:2015 certificate (check validity date and certification body accreditation)
  • Certificate scope (does it cover security camera manufacturing specifically?)
  • Stainless steel material certificates (grade 304/316 mill test reports)
  • Product certification for target markets (CE, FCC, IMDA, SIRIM, etc.)
  • Warranty terms documentation (duration, coverage, claim process)
  • Technical specification sheets (detailed, not marketing brochures)
  • Factory audit reports (if available from third parties)

Phase 2: Technical Capability Assessment

During initial supplier communication, evaluate:

  • Response time and communication quality (indicates service capability)
  • Willingness to provide sample units for testing
  • Customization flexibility (housing material, firmware, branding)
  • Production lead time consistency
  • Quality control process documentation
  • After-sales support structure (regional service centers, spare parts availability)
  • Reference customer contacts (similar market/application)

Phase 3: Sample Testing and Validation

Before placing bulk orders, conduct thorough sample testing:

  • Environmental testing (humidity chamber, salt spray for stainless steel verification)
  • Functional testing (all advertised features, firmware stability)
  • Durability testing (impact resistance, connector cycling)
  • Image quality assessment (resolution, low-light performance, color accuracy)
  • Integration testing (compatibility with your VMS/NVR systems)
  • Documentation review (user manuals, installation guides, API documentation)

Documentation Requirements for Southeast Asian Imports

Successfully importing security cameras into Southeast Asian markets requires comprehensive documentation. ISO 9001 certified suppliers are typically better equipped to provide complete documentation packages, but buyers should verify requirements for their specific target markets.

Essential Documentation Package:

1. Commercial Documents:

  • Commercial Invoice (detailed, with HS codes)
  • Packing List (carton dimensions, weights, quantities)
  • Bill of Lading / Air Waybill
  • Certificate of Origin (for preferential tariff treatment under ASEAN agreements)

2. Quality and Compliance Documents:

  • ISO 9001 Certificate (copy, verify validity)
  • Product Test Reports (from accredited laboratories)
  • Material Certificates (stainless steel grade verification)
  • CE / FCC / RoHS Certificates (if applicable)
  • Country-specific certifications (IMDA, SIRIM, TISI, SNI, etc.)

3. Technical Documents:

  • Product Specification Sheets
  • User Manuals (English + local language if required)
  • Installation Guides
  • Warranty Terms Documentation
  • Spare Parts List

4. Customs and Import Documents:

  • Import License (if required in destination country)
  • Product Registration Certificates
  • Safety Compliance Declarations
  • Intellectual Property Declarations (trademark, patent)

Common Documentation Pitfalls to Avoid:

  • Inconsistent product descriptions across documents (causes customs delays)
  • Missing or expired certificates (verify all validity dates before shipment)
  • Incomplete technical specifications (may trigger additional testing requirements)
  • Language requirements not met (some countries require local language manuals)
  • Country of origin documentation errors (affects tariff treatment)
